From 07c005cf28acf74e3afde82122e4c53e1000d70c Mon Sep 17 00:00:00 2001 From: king <18310653075@163.com> Date: 星期一, 12 六月 2023 12:06:18 +0800 Subject: [PATCH] Merge branch 'master' into positec --- src/tabviews/home/defaulthome/index.jsx | 49 +++++++++++++++++++++++++------------------------ 1 files changed, 25 insertions(+), 24 deletions(-) diff --git a/src/tabviews/home/defaulthome/index.jsx b/src/tabviews/home/defaulthome/index.jsx index fc95665..67ec6dd 100644 --- a/src/tabviews/home/defaulthome/index.jsx +++ b/src/tabviews/home/defaulthome/index.jsx @@ -1,9 +1,8 @@ import React, {Component} from 'react' import { Chart } from '@antv/g2' -import { Icon, Tabs, Slider } from 'antd' +import { Progress } from 'antd' +import { InfoCircleOutlined, CaretUpOutlined, CaretDownOutlined } from '@ant-design/icons' import './index.scss' - -const { TabPane } = Tabs class DefaultHome extends Component { componentDidMount () { @@ -16,6 +15,8 @@ { year: '2018 骞�', sales: 38 }, { year: '2019 骞�', sales: 61 }, { year: '2020 骞�', sales: 45 }, + { year: '2021 骞�', sales: 55 }, + { year: '2022 骞�', sales: 49 }, ] const chart = new Chart({ container: 'home_page_id', @@ -58,7 +59,7 @@ <span>缁翠慨鎬绘暟</span> </span> <span className="antd-action"> - <Icon type="info-circle-o" /> + <InfoCircleOutlined /> </span> </div> <div className="antd-total"> @@ -74,7 +75,7 @@ <span className="antd-trend-text">10%</span> </span> <span className="antd-trend-up"> - <Icon type="caret-up" /> + <CaretUpOutlined /> </span> </div> <div className="antd-trend-item"> @@ -83,7 +84,7 @@ <span className="antd-trend-text">10%</span> </span> <span className="antd-trend-down"> - <Icon type="caret-down" /> + <CaretDownOutlined /> </span> </div> </div> @@ -111,7 +112,7 @@ <span>瓒呮椂宸ュ崟</span> </span> <span className="antd-action"> - <Icon type="info-circle-o" /> + <InfoCircleOutlined /> </span> </div> <div className="antd-total"> @@ -120,9 +121,8 @@ </div> </div> <div className="antd-chart-content"> - <div className="antd-content-fixed orange"> - <Slider defaultValue={67} tipFormatter={null} /> - <div className="mask"></div> + <div className="antd-content-fixed"> + <Progress percent={67} showInfo={false} strokeColor="orange"/> </div> </div> <div className="antd-chart-footer"> @@ -148,7 +148,7 @@ <span>鍏冲崟</span> </span> <span className="antd-action"> - <Icon type="info-circle-o" /> + <InfoCircleOutlined /> </span> </div> <div className="antd-total"> @@ -158,8 +158,7 @@ </div> <div className="antd-chart-content"> <div className="antd-content-fixed primary"> - <Slider defaultValue={77} tipFormatter={null} /> - <div className="mask"></div> + <Progress percent={77} showInfo={false} strokeColor="#1890ff"/> </div> </div> <div className="antd-chart-footer"> @@ -185,7 +184,7 @@ <span>鍘熶欢閭瘎</span> </span> <span className="antd-action"> - <Icon type="info-circle-o" /> + <InfoCircleOutlined /> </span> </div> <div className="antd-total"> @@ -195,8 +194,7 @@ </div> <div className="antd-chart-content"> <div className="antd-content-fixed"> - <Slider defaultValue={87} tipFormatter={null} /> - <div className="mask"></div> + <Progress percent={87} showInfo={false} strokeColor="#13C2C2"/> </div> </div> <div className="antd-chart-footer"> @@ -206,7 +204,7 @@ <span className="antd-trend-text">10%</span> </span> <span className="antd-trend-up"> - <Icon type="caret-up" /> + <CaretUpOutlined /> </span> </div> <div className="antd-trend-item"> @@ -215,7 +213,7 @@ <span className="antd-trend-text">10%</span> </span> <span className="antd-trend-down"> - <Icon type="caret-down" /> + <CaretDownOutlined /> </span> </div> </div> @@ -224,12 +222,15 @@ </div> </div> </div> - <Tabs defaultActiveKey="1"> - <TabPane tab="缁翠慨鎬绘暟" key="1"> - <div className="sale-trend ant-col ant-col-xs-16"> + <div className="home-board"> + <div className="mk-home-title"> + <span>缁翠慨鎬绘暟</span> + </div> + <div className="mk-home-body"> + <div className="sale-trend ant-col-left"> <div id="home_page_id"></div> </div> - <div className="ant-col ant-col-xs-8"> + <div className="ant-col-right"> <div className="antd-sales-rank"> <h4 className="antd-ranking-title">浜у搧鎺掑悕</h4> <ul className="antd-ranking-list"> @@ -276,8 +277,8 @@ </ul> </div> </div> - </TabPane> - </Tabs> + </div> + </div> </div> ) } -- Gitblit v1.8.0